Action item: The Relayn deploy-status bot silently dropped updates when the pipeline API paginated results, so responders believed a rollback had completed when it had not. We will add pagination handling, a staleness banner, and an integration test. Until merged, verify deploy state directly in the pipeline console, documented at the page below.

runbook for kahop-kajop: https://rundeck.ordinio.test/display/secrets/pipeline/issue/pages/repo/browse/e5732776e07d1285107e5aeb

## Changelog — v4.2.0 (Fennwick Gateway)

The setting `ws_deflate` has been renamed to `socket_compression_mode` to clarify that per-message deflate trades CPU for bandwidth; plugins handling large binary frames should prefer `off`. The old name is accepted with a deprecation warning until v5. Plugins negotiating compression directly with the broker must now authenticate that handshake, which requires adding the following line to your env file:

env line for fafof-fahag: LEDGER_TOKEN5=f8790

Ticket TTS-219: Timetable solver staging env missing auth entry

Release manager: the Chalkline solver's staging deploy at Bramwell Academy Group failed overnight because the env file was regenerated from the wrong template, dropping the constraint-service credential. Schedules stalled at the validation step. All other variables verified correct against the deploy manifest. To unblock tonight's release, the credential must be appended on the line immediately following this one.

env line for bawif-kadup: ARCHIVE_KEY3=584

Memo to sales leads: the Ardental Classic line will be retired over the next three quarters. Continue fulfilling existing orders; no new multi-year commitments after month-end. Migration incentives to the Ardental Pro line are approved and documented separately. Handle customer conversations carefully. The reasoning behind the timing appears below.

confidential, bahof-yaweg: Headcount on the Kaseth team goes from 32 to 109 by the end of January. Gross margin on Kaseth came in at 46 percent against a plan of 45 percent.